What are the most common challenges faced by an Assistant Long Distance Delivery Driver, and how can they be managed effectively?

Assistant Long Distance Delivery Drivers often encounter challenges such as navigating unfamiliar routes, managing fatigue during extended trips, and maintaining timely deliveries despite traffic or weather conditions. Effective communication with the lead driver and dispatcher, using GPS and route planning tools, and adhering to scheduled breaks can help manage these challenges. Building strong teamwork skills is also essential, as assistants frequently collaborate on loading, unloading, and ensuring cargo safety throughout the journey.

What are Assistant Long Distance Delivery Drivers?

Assistant Long Distance Delivery Drivers support primary drivers in transporting goods over long distances, such as between cities or states. Their duties typically include helping with navigation, loading and unloading cargo, completing required paperwork, and ensuring deliveries are made safely and on schedule. They may also assist with vehicle inspections, minor maintenance, and compliance with transportation regulations. This role is essential for efficient and safe delivery operations, especially on extended routes that require teamwork and adherence to strict delivery timelines.

What is the difference between Assistant Long Distance Delivery Driver vs Delivery Driver?

AspectAssistant Long Distance Delivery DriverDelivery Driver
CredentialsValid driver’s license, possibly CDL; background checkValid driver’s license; background check
Work EnvironmentLong-distance routes, often overnight; loading/unloadingLocal or regional routes; direct customer delivery
Employer & IndustryCourier companies, logistics firmsRetail, food services, e-commerce

The Assistant Long Distance Delivery Driver typically handles longer routes, assisting with loading, navigation, and delivery over extended distances. In contrast, a Delivery Driver usually focuses on local or regional deliveries, often within a city or area. Both roles require valid licenses and involve driving, but the scope and environment differ significantly, with the assistant role emphasizing support during long hauls.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Assistant Long Distance Delivery Driver,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Assistant Long Distance Delivery Driver, you typically need a valid driver’s license, a good driving record, and basic knowledge of route planning and cargo handling. Familiarity with GPS navigation systems, electronic logging devices (ELDs), and basic vehicle maintenance tools is essential. Strong communication, reliability, and teamwork skills help in coordinating with drivers, dispatchers, and customers. These abilities ensure safe, timely deliveries and smooth operations over extended routes.
